Q&A

How does the nitric acid boiling method work for gold extraction?

The nitric acid boiling method involves using nitric acid to remove impurities, such as base metals, from gold scraps. The acid reacts with the metals, leaving behind purified gold.

Are there any risks involved in the gold extraction process?

The nitric acid boiling method can be hazardous if not performed with proper safety precautions. It is essential to work in a well-ventilated area, wear protective gear, and handle the acid with care.

What happens to the base metals and impurities removed during the process?

The base metals and impurities form a solution with the nitric acid and are separated from the gold. The solution can be processed separately to recover any valuable metals or disposed of properly.

Can the gold extraction process be performed with other types of metal scraps?

While the nitric acid boiling method is commonly used for gold extraction, it may not be suitable for all types of metal scraps. It is essential to research and consult experts to determine the most appropriate refining method for specific metals.

Is the nitric acid boiling method the most efficient way to extract gold from scrap?

The nitric acid boiling method is one of the popular methods for gold extraction from scrap. However, there are other techniques available, such as cyanide leaching and smelting, which may be more efficient depending on the specific application and requirements.
